Two- and three particle azimuthal correlations of high-pT charged hadrons in Pb-Au collisions at 158 AGeV/c

Description

The suppression of high-pT particles observed in heavy-ion collisions at RHIC has been connected to a significant final state interaction of the hard-scattered parton with a dense color-charged medium. A recent re-evaluation of high-pt data from SPS indicates that moderate suppression may also be observed at SPS energy. The analysis of azimuthal correlations of charged hadrons at high-pT provides deeper insight into modifications of the fragmentation process and the response of the medium. Similar to observations at RHIC, significant modifications of the di-jet structure have also been observed by the CERES experiment at SPS. In order to discriminate between different scenarios of the parton-medium interaction, such as jet deflection or shock wave creation, the study has been extended to investigations of three-particle correlations. We present recent results on two- and three particle correlations from the CERES experiment and discuss possible implications on the mechanism of parton interaction with the hot and dense medium created in heavy-ion collisions at SPS.
